Program Analysis
Graduates of the Liberal Arts and Sciences, General Studies and Humanities program at Saginaw Valley State University earn a median salary of $40,740 one year after graduation. Five years after graduation, the median salary increases to $56,972. These earnings are higher than the national average for this major, which is $37,560.
The graduates of this program have no reported debt. This results in a debt-to-earnings ratio of zero.
The program graduates approximately 15 students per year.
